Logo
Yicheng Luo's profile picture#837

Yicheng Luo

@ethanluoyc
London, United Kingdom
University College London
United Kingdom

GitHub Followers

284

Public Contributions

36

Country Rank

#837 in United Kingdom

Developer Information

GitHub Profile

github.com/ethanluoyc

About Yicheng Luo

Yicheng Luo is a GitHub developer from United Kingdom, currently ranked #837 in the country. With 284 followers and 36 public contributions,Yicheng Luo is among the most influential developers in United Kingdom.

View Yicheng Luo's complete GitHub profile to explore repositories, contributions, and more.